#68c503 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#68c503 is composed of 40.8% red, 77.3% green and 1.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 47.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 98.5% yellow and 22.7% black. It has a hue angle of 88.8 degrees, a saturation of 97% and a lightness of 39.2%. #68c503 color hex could be obtained by blending #d0ff06 with #008b00. Closest websafe color is: #66cc00.

#68c503 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#68c503 has RGB values of R:104, G:197, B:3 and CMYK values of C:0.47, M:0, Y:0.98, K:0.23. Its decimal value is 6866179.

Shades and Tints of #68c503
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020400 is the darkest color, while #f7ffef is the lightest one.
